The Japanese promotions:

All Japan Pro Wrestling, Michinoku Pro Wrestling, New Japan Pro Wrestling, Osaka Pro Wrestling, Pro Wrestling NOAH and Zero-One are all still currently active promotions.

BattlArts closed in 2011.

Pride formally shut down this year.

Toryumon exists but it does not. In 2004 The core of Toryumon Japan (including Naoki Tanisaki of Toryumon X) separtated from Ultimo Dragon and turned the remains into Dragon Gate. Since then only one Toryumon branded show happened. Similar to the closure of Smash leading to Wrestling New Classic being formed.

Wrestling Marvelous Future (which acts as DDT in the game) closed down in 2008.

World Japan (which acts as K-Dojo in the game) has not been around on a regular basis since 2004.

Toryumon is weird in that it evolved right into Dragon Gate. The only differences are slight presentation differences, the name and Ultimo Dragon is not the owner. I would leave them in as is mainly due to this fact. Sorry for the confusion but it is not as clear-cut as the other promotions closing entirely while Toryumon just changed ownership and names.
